Featured Featured 19 June, 2023 - 25 June, 2023 Queens 2023 Queens Club Palliser Rd, West Kinsington Enquire now for hospitality packages to Queen's
20 June, 2023 - 24 June, 2023 Royal Ascot 2023 Ascot Racecourse Ascot, Berkshire Hospitality to Royal Ascot 2023 available
Featured Featured 23 June, 2023 Sportingclass London Polo 2023 Ham Polo Club Petersham Road, Richmond Save the date! London Polo Day 2023